1. Karnataka Bypolls: Cong-JD(S) Win 4 Seats, Bag BJP Bastion Ballari

Counting for five constituencies going to bypolls took place in Karnataka on Tuesday, 6 November, with the Congress-JD(S) winning the Jamkhandi and Ramanagaram Assembly seats and Ballari and Mandya Lok Sabha seats, while BJP won the Shimoga Lok Sabha seat.

While the Congress dubbed the win as a reflection of the mood of the nation, the BJP called the party’s poor show a “warning”.

2. Maneka Gandhi Calls Tigress Avni’s Killing a ‘Murder’

Days after tigress Avni was shot dead in Maharashtra’s Yavatmal district, shooter Asgar Ali maintained that he shot her in self-defence and denied the “trigger-happy allegations” levelled against him.

In a series of tweets on Sunday, Union Minister Maneka Gandhi had said, "It is nothing but a straight case of crime. Despite several requests from many stakeholders, (Sudhir) Mungantiwar, minister for forests, Maharashtra, gave orders for the killing."

3. US Midterm Elections Underway

Republicans have a huge advantage as they seek to hold or expand their 51-49 Senate majority, with the battle for control running mostly through states that President Donald Trump won in 2016.

Out of the 35 Senate contests taking place on Tuesday, 6 November, 10 involve Democratic incumbents seeking re-election in states that Trump won, often handily. He's spending much of the final week before the election traveling to those states in the hope that it will nudge his supporters to the polls.
